I am with Keir on this one.  A large minority of the sys admins at my
school use zsh.  In an effort to make converting easier they provide a
pretty usable default environment.  When I first logged in, I was
like, "What they heck!  This thing is totally broken.  Why is this
doing such and such?  Where is such and such?"  Once I figured out
what they where doing, I just added *one* new option to my .zshenv:

setopt NO_GLOBAL_RCS

Done deal.  Now new zsh-converts get a usable environment that they
can choose to customize or simply use as is, and I'm happy because
none of their stuff effects me.
